Definition of interlocutors:
(n) :
A person who takes part in dialogue or conversation: a locutive partner.
(n) :
A man in the middle of the line in a minstrel show who questions the endmen and acts as leader.
(n) :
(law) An interlocutory judgement or sentence.
(n) :
(Scots law) A decree of a court.
